Reaxys combines the Beilstein (organic chem), Gmelin (inorganic chem), and Chemical Patents databases into one search interface. Users can search by structure, substructure, reaction, text, and property data. Reaxys indexes experimental reaction data and chemical/physical properties for over 10 million compounds and 22 million reactions. Information originates from around 3800 journals and patents from various patent offices. 1771-present No

Experts define risk as a combination of the magnitude and probability of adverse effects. Risk Abstracts provides a comprehensive source for interdisciplinary perspectives in this evolving field. Published in association with the Institute for Risk Research at the University of Waterloo, Risk Abstracts encompasses risk arising from industrial, technological, environmental, and other sources, with an emphasis on assessment and management of risk. The broad, multidisciplinary coverage of risk-related concerns ranges from public and environmental health to social issues and psychological aspects. <p> Over 1350 journal titles are selectively indexed by Risk Abstracts. 1990 - present Partial
